A doctor's note: 'Somehow, Mr O’Sullivan managed to fight and win two weeks after suffering this injury'

I’ve had friends and colleagues tell me I’d be mad to reveal a brutal injury like this. Any future opponent now knows where I’ve been damaged. But I’m a 41-year-old who’s spent most of his life fighting

A STRETCH: ‘Spike’ O’Sullivan punching his way to a comeback - if painful - victory at the National Stadium over Mateusz Pawlowski. Pic: Laszlo Geczo, Inpho

Last month at the National Stadium, I sat down on my stool between rounds and thought to myself “they’re going have to have someone come in here and sweep the ring between rounds!” 

It wasn’t because the canvas was crimson with the spills of battle. No. It was my bloody shorts. They were disintegrating with every step I took, threads and fluff and bits of fabric floating down.
